Product Description

by John Mary Meagher (Author)

Dr. Meagher, an Emergency Room Physician, drawing on his own and colleagues' experiences, researches the nature of error. He demonstrates that these mistakes are often due to several overlapping factors, rooted in the instinctual responses from the "old" part of our brains - those that seem to have developed first. This is what is called the reptilian brain. By recognizing the effect of this "reptilian brain" on our actions and most importantly, our mistakes, we can take steps (The NewMind Response (TM)) to curb the reptilian responses, making each of us more effective, empathetic and less error prone.

Author Biography

John Mary Meagher graduated in medicine from the National University of Ireland, Dublin and has worked for forty years as a family physician and emergency room physician.The Theorem of Attribution, The NewMind Response(TM) and "Medicine, Mistakes and the Reptilian Brain" is the product of eleven years research. His thesis novel called "A Bluebell in a Quarry" and poems and essays have been previously published. Meagher lives with his wife, Bernadette, in Moncton, Canada.
